I have a friend who is attempting to restore a really rusty 79 LRE truck and has found a squeaky clean 85 cab...from a sheet metal/feasibility standpoint is this possible? His desire of course would be to use the 79 LRE components in the 85 cab...is this doable? Thanks!

Cabs from 72 -80 have similar body profile but even then there are differences (mostly in the fire wall i.e... heater boxes, Bulkhead) The body changed (rounded vs squared off)in 81 for the single cab but stayed rounded for the duration of Club and Crew cabs.
